Williams in the hit Fox drama <em>New York Undercover<\/em>. He also played a role as a Jamaican bobsledder in the classic comedy <em><a href=\"https:\/\/www.rottentomatoes.com\/m\/1046227-cool_runnings\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Cool Runnings<\/a><\/em>.&nbsp;Since then, Yoba has kept busy writing and acting on hit shows like <em>Empire<\/em> and <em>Girlfriends<\/em>, while ramping up to participate in New York\u2019s highly-anticipated legal cannabis market.<\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/www.leafly.com\/dispensaries\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Leafly<\/a> caught up with the veteran performer in New Orleans at the Black CannaConference, where he shared his feelings on how legal weed will impact his hometown of New York City. He told me that this was just his second ever canna-conference, adding that he felt \u201clike a student.\u201d <\/p>\n<p>Thanks to his years of experience in film and television, Yoba has considerable expertise and talents to bring to the budding field of legal cannabis. While speaking on a panel at the conference, Yoba revealed plans to enter the weed industry. \u201cI\u2019ve always been into cannabis,\u201d he told me in a one-on-one meeting after his panel. \u201cI\u2019ve known about cannabis all my life. Certainly, since I was a kid.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>The first time Yoba consumed cannabis was in middle school. \u201cI was 12 or 13,\u201d he remembers. \u201cIt was always about relaxation. But I don\u2019t know if people even realized that\u2019s what they were doing it for.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It was also about being an artist,\u201d he adds. \u201cIt\u2019s a tradition you hear about. My father was a <a href=\"https:\/\/www.leafly.com\/learn\/legalization\/marijuana-illegal-history\">jazz musician<\/a>. He smoked weed. His friends did. It was just around. I didn\u2019t start thinking about it for medicinal purposes until more recently. As I mentioned from the stage, now I use it for pain management and also for sleep.\u201d<\/p>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img width=\"1024\" height=\"683\" alt=\"Welcome To New York City: Malik Yoba Talks NYC, Legalization &amp; Making Scripted TV Shows Inspired by Cannabis\" class=\"wp-image-196040 has-ll lazyload\" data-srcset=\"https:\/\/thcinct.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/03\/actor-malik-yoba-has-big-plans-for-nycs-legal-weed-scene-1.jpg,compress&amp;w=550 550w, https:\/\/thcinct.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/03\/actor-malik-yoba-has-big-plans-for-nycs-legal-weed-scene-1.jpg,compress&amp;w=740 740w, https:\/\/thcinct.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/03\/actor-malik-yoba-has-big-plans-for-nycs-legal-weed-scene-1.jpg,compress&amp;w=1100 1100w, https:\/\/thcinct.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/03\/actor-malik-yoba-has-big-plans-for-nycs-legal-weed-scene-1.jpg,compress&amp;w=1480 1480w\"><figcaption>Welcome To New York City: Malik Yoba Talks NYC, Legalization &amp; Making Scripted TV Shows Inspired by Cannabis<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>With legal weed on the horizon in his home state, the Bronx native still laughs recalling how much stress once came with the plant.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cI did try to sell once in high school,\u201d he remembers. \u201cThis dude that was dealing in the street in Washington Square Park, he dropped his whole bag. It was like bush weed with a bunch of seeds and sticks. I took it, but I was too scared to sell it.\u201d<\/p>\n<h2>On the opportunities he sees for NYC\u2019s legal cannabis market<\/h2>\n<p>New York will soon be home to one of the world\u2019s largest legal weed markets. And Yoba is optimistic about his ability to help expand the industry. He wants to de-stigmatize the plant on the screen, and behind the scenes, by opening career opportunities in cannabis.<\/p>\n<p>\u201c(We) see the writing on the wall, man,\u201d he tells me as we discuss the possibilities of legal pot in Gotham City. \u201cThere\u2019s just too much money. New York is the financial capital of the country. So I\u2019m excited to be a part of it. Especially from the real estate side.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>The cannabis industry has already created a massive amount of jobs (see our <a href=\"https:\/\/www.leafly.com\/news\/industry\/cannabis-jobs-report\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Jobs Report<\/a>) and tax dollars in states that have legalized. But New York\u2019s commercial and cultural influence is <em>different<\/em>. And Yoba believes green could bring a new golden era to his city.<\/p>\n<p> <a href=\"https:\/\/www.leafly.com\/news\/industry\/cannabis-jobs-report\" class=\"wp-block-leafly-blocks-leafly-single-inline-block leafly-inline-related-story\"><\/p>\n<div class=\"border border-deep-green-alt border-l-0 border-r-0 my-xl p-md font-bold\">\n<p>Related<\/p>\n<p>The US cannabis industry now supports 428,059 jobs<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<p><\/a> <\/p>\n<p>\u201cWhat I\u2019m appreciating about what\u2019s happening is that people are thinking about business in a different way. People are saying, \u2018I don\u2019t have to just do one thing.\u2019\u201d His passion boils over when speaking on the abundance of ancillary opportunities available in the legal cannabis industry. <\/p>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-pullquote is-style-solid-color\">\n<blockquote>\n<p>\u201cIt\u2019s good to see that people want to do more than just get a dispensary. There\u2019s the legal aspect. There\u2019s the marketing aspect. There\u2019s the media aspect\u2026 There\u2019s the growers, the distribution, the construction\u2026 There\u2019s a whole ecosystem.\u201d<\/p>\n<p><cite><strong>\u2013 <\/strong>Malik Yoba<em> on the wide range of opportunities in New York\u2019s legal cannabis industry<\/em><\/cite><\/p><\/blockquote>\n<\/figure>\n<p>Selling pickaxes in a gold rush has been a <a href=\"https:\/\/www.businessinsider.com\/selling-pickaxes-during-a-gold-rush-2011-2\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">proven business strategy<\/a> for centuries. And Yoba intends to use his real estate and media skills to lead others into the bountiful field of legal weed he sees clearly ahead once the plant can be legally exchanged.<\/p>\n<p>\u201c(People are) sharing information. They\u2019re saying, \u2018I don\u2019t just have to do one thing.&#8217;\u201d He continues, \u201cBecause most peoples\u2019 point of entry has been the flower itself, they forget about all that other stuff.\u201d<\/p>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img width=\"1024\" height=\"641\" alt class=\"wp-image-7160 has-ll lazyload\" data-srcset=\"https:\/\/thcinct.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/03\/actor-malik-yoba-has-big-plans-for-nycs-legal-weed-scene-2.jpg,compress&amp;w=550 550w, https:\/\/thcinct.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/03\/actor-malik-yoba-has-big-plans-for-nycs-legal-weed-scene-2.jpg,compress&amp;w=740 740w, https:\/\/thcinct.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/03\/actor-malik-yoba-has-big-plans-for-nycs-legal-weed-scene-2.jpg,compress&amp;w=1100 1100w, https:\/\/thcinct.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/03\/actor-malik-yoba-has-big-plans-for-nycs-legal-weed-scene-2.jpg,compress&amp;w=1480 1480w\"><figcaption>New York, NY, USA \u2013 November 13, 2014: Union Square and New York City shot from an office building just south of Union Square<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<h2>On New York\u2019s approach to social equity<\/h2>\n<p>\u201cWe haven\u2019t really been invited to the party at the same level,\u201d Yoba says of Black and Brown inclusion in other legal states. But so far, he is happy with New York\u2019s Office of Cannabis and its approach to maximizing access and social equity in the industry.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cWhat I\u2019m hearing from the state are all the efforts that are being made to make sure that there is greater equity and inclusion. Specifically, the hundreds of licenses set aside for individuals who did time.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Yoba feels a deep responsibility to give back to the communities that sacrificed to make the current industry possible.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cFor most of us (in the cannabis industry), it\u2019s mission work. People aren\u2019t just going to the job to do the job, they\u2019re like, \u2018I\u2019m gonna meet my expectations and make my money. But I\u2019m making sure that I\u2019m bringing our folks along.&#8217;\u201d <\/p>\n<p> <a href=\"https:\/\/www.leafly.com\/news\/politics\/new-york-city-weed-dealers-on-legalization-theyre-not-worried-about-competition\" class=\"wp-block-leafly-blocks-leafly-single-inline-block leafly-inline-related-story\"><\/p>\n<div class=\"border border-deep-green-alt border-l-0 border-r-0 my-xl p-md font-bold\">\n<p>Related<\/p>\n<p>Here\u2019s how New York City\u2019s weed dealers are preparing for legalization<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<p><\/a> <\/p>\n<p>Barriers to entry like real estate and access to capital have lead to legal oligopolies in states like Florida, where less than 20 licensed retailers serve over. But New York\u2019s Office of Cannabis Management and residents like Yoba are intent on not letting a similar scenario play out on their watch.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cI care about the freedom of our people,\u201d Yoba told me at Black CannaConference. \u201cWe have to know that certain things are possible.\u201d<\/p>\n<h2>On his potential for influencing NYC\u2019s legal weed industry<\/h2>\n<p>Yoba doesn\u2019t intend to be a taker in this budding field. And he\u2019s confident in the will of the state and the people for NYC to be just as big as California within the next decade. <\/p>\n<p>Yoba says he\u2019s privy to the plans for the state\u2019s first 150 dispensary locations. And he has faith that the Office of Cannabis Management and new Governor Kathy Hochul will be able to avoid the road bumps other states have run into since legalizing.<\/p>\n<h2>Fulfilling the dream of a greener New York<\/h2>\n<p>Yoba, like many New York residents, had a hard time envisioning how the legal weed industry would play out at first. <\/p>\n<p>Some residents are growing less optimistic, as medical and recreational shoppers patiently await the legal market\u2019s sluggish rollout. But Yoba is seeing firsthand that it takes time to build out a successful market anywhere\u2013 let alone a state that\u2019s home to the financial capital of the world.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cNow I get to see it from the business side.<strong> <\/strong>There are people who have been positioning themselves that I know for years, over a decade in some cases to be successful in this space.\u201d And the more I\u2019ve started paying attention to friends nudging me towards this space.\u201d So far, he\u2019s in on CBD beverage company with a childhood friend.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cOnce it became legal in New York, I said, \u2018Let me take a close look.\u2019 And then I jumped in with both feet recently\u2026 I have a piece in a company called So Cloud Water, a CBD beverage,\u201d he told me, before adding, \u201cThere are already major beverage companies trying to get into that side of the industry.\u201d<\/p>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-full\"><img width=\"618\" height=\"412\" alt class=\"wp-image-196093 has-ll lazyload\" data-srcset=\"https:\/\/thcinct.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/03\/actor-malik-yoba-has-big-plans-for-nycs-legal-weed-scene-4.jpg,compress&amp;w=550 550w, https:\/\/thcinct.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/03\/actor-malik-yoba-has-big-plans-for-nycs-legal-weed-scene-4.jpg,compress&amp;w=740 740w, https:\/\/thcinct.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/03\/actor-malik-yoba-has-big-plans-for-nycs-legal-weed-scene-4.jpg,compress&amp;w=1100 1100w, https:\/\/thcinct.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/03\/actor-malik-yoba-has-big-plans-for-nycs-legal-weed-scene-4.jpg,compress&amp;w=1480 1480w\"><figcaption>Malik Yoba is a Bronx native with a bright vision for New York\u2019s upcoming legal weed scene.
